Abstract

For the stationary case the canonical formalism of thermally dissipative fields with both positive- and negative-frequency parts is constructed. This formulation enables one to follow the self-consistent renormalization scheme which creates the dissipation spontaneously. The self-interacting φ3 model is examined as an example of the spontaneous creation of dissipation. The parameter α appearing in the thermal state conditions as well as observables independent of the choice of α are discussed.
